概括
金属表面在没有溶解离子的情况下激活DNA酶. 这一发现将DNA酶催化扩展到新的界面环境中,使用金属表面作为增强活性的辅助因子.
科学领域:
- 生物化学 生物化学
- 材料科学 材料科学 材料科学
- 纳米技术纳米技术
背景情况:
- 传统上,DNA酶需要溶解的金属离子进行催化活动.
- 催化通常发生在基于同质溶液的系统中.
研究的目的:
- 为了研究金属表面对DNA酶的直接激活.
- 探索金属表面作为DNA酶催化剂的新型辅因子.
- 为DNA酶反应建立异质的接口环境.
主要方法:
- 采用了自我裂变的DNAzyme (PL) 和各种金属表面 (铜,,).
- 通过对非金属表面 (塑料,玻璃,木材) 的测试来研究材料特异性.
- 进行了涉及溶解氧,超氧化离子和各种抑制剂/增强剂的机制研究.
主要成果:
- 在固体-液体接口的特定金属表面上证明了DNAzyme PL的直接激活.
- 鉴定了由金属-氧反应产生的超氧化离子作为DNA裂变的关键触发因素.
- 展示了各种化学剂对反应的特定材料激活和调制.
- 在其他DNA酶 (F-8,Ag10c,I-R3) 中观察到类似的金属表面介导激活.
结论:
- 宏观的金属表面可以作为DNA酶的直接辅因子.
- 这项工作扩展了DNA酶催化从同质到异质接口系统.
- 在材料集成设备和生物传感器中为DNAzyme应用开辟了新的途径.

Catalysis
30.1K
The presence of a catalyst affects the rate of a chemical reaction. A catalyst is a substance that can increase the reaction rate without being consumed during the process. A basic comprehension of a catalysts’ role during chemical reactions can be understood from the concept of reaction mechanisms and energy diagrams.

Cleavage and Blastulation
49.9K
After a large-single-celled zygote is produced via fertilization, the process of cleavage occurs while zygotes travel through the uterine tube. Cleavage is a mitotic cell division that does not result in growth. With each round of successive cell division, daughter cells get increasingly smaller.

Metallic Solids
20.5K
Metallic solids such as crystals of copper, aluminum, and iron are formed by metal atoms. The structure of metallic crystals is often described as a uniform distribution of atomic nuclei within a “sea” of delocalized electrons. The atoms within such a metallic solid are held together by a unique force known as metallic bonding that gives rise to many useful and varied bulk properties.
All metallic solids exhibit high thermal and electrical conductivity, metallic luster, and malleability....

Overview of DNA Repair
33.5K
In order to be passed through generations, genomic DNA must be undamaged and error-free. However, every day, DNA in a cell undergoes several thousand to a million damaging events by natural causes and external factors. Ionizing radiation such as UV rays, free radicals produced during cellular respiration, and hydrolytic damage from metabolic reactions can alter the structure of DNA. Damages caused include single-base alteration, base dimerization, chain breaks, and cross-linkage.

Introduction to Mechanisms of Enzyme Catalysis
10.5K
For many years, scientists thought that enzyme-substrate binding took place in a simple "lock-and-key" fashion. This model stated that the enzyme and substrate fit together perfectly in one instantaneous step. However, current research supports a more refined view scientists call induced fit.
